Least Common Multiple of 86144 and 86149 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 86144 and 86149, than apply into the LCM equation.

GCF(86144,86149) = 1
LCM(86144,86149) = ( 86144 × 86149) / 1
LCM(86144,86149) = 7421219456 / 1
LCM(86144,86149) = 7421219456
